The annual salary statistics of occupational therapy assistants in Beaumont-Port Arthur, Texas is shown in Table 1. The wage statistics of occupational therapy assistants in Beaumont-Port Arthur is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
|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ile Wage | $52,920 |
| 25th Percentile Wage | $63,910 |
| 50th Percentile Wage | $79,670 |
| 75th Percentile Wage | $88,200 |
| 90th Percentile Wage | $95,270 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for occupational therapy assistants in Beaumont-Port Arthur, Texas in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$95,270.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$79,670.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$52,920.
